Output 68a57415b843f18e4a0039ebb205b796c5a37042f7fb98cf95e2ad03aea55e27:0

value
52017681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e33a9222333d2270b9c4e201c5e4f930798b9e OP_EQUALVERIFY OP_CHECKSIG
address
1DPWS2mCqjhxdtbbNeFNrXJN9E5ThGvr7S
transaction
68a57415b843f18e4a0039ebb205b796c5a37042f7fb98cf95e2ad03aea55e27
spent
true